离子色谱法同时测定降水中的常见阴离子

Simultaneous Determination of Anions in Rainwater by Ion Chromatography

【摘要】 利用离子色谱仪同时测定降水中的3种有机酸根离子和4种无机阴离子,通过对分析条件的优化,确定了最佳的色谱条件:以4.0 mmol/L Na2CO3与1.0 mmol/L NaHCO3为流动相,流速0.8 mL/m in作等度洗脱,在10 m in内实现基线分离并完成电导检测.7种组分的检测限在0.5~20.0 nmol/L之间,线性范围跨越2个数量级以上.该方法用于雨水样品的分析,结果表明:平均加标回收率为92.1%~106.2%,相对标准偏差0.30%~4.03%.

【Abstract】 A method for simultaneous separation and determination of 3 organic acids and 4 anions in rainfall samples by ion chromatography coupled with conductimetric detection was proposed.The 7 analytes were separated by isocratic elution with the mobile phase of 4.0 mmol/L Na2CO3 and 1.0 mmol/L NaHCO3 at a flow rate of 0.8 mL/min,and were detected directly by conductimetric detector.Under the optimized conditions,the detection limits for 7 analytes were 0.5-20.0 nmol/L.The linear ranges were beyond two orders of magnitude.The analytical method had been applied to the determination of 7 anions in rainfall samples.The recovery(92.1%-106.2%) and RSD(0.30%-4.03%)results were obtained.
